Introduction to Cryptocurrency Lotteries

Cryptocurrency lotteries operate similarly to conventional petirjitu lotteries, allowing participants to purchase tickets for a chance to win prizes. However, what sets them apart is the utilization of cryptocurrencies as the primary medium of exchange. This innovative approach introduces several unique advantages and challenges.

Advantages of Cryptocurrency Lotteries

One of the key advantages of cryptocurrency lotteries is transparency and fairness. Blockchain technology ensures that every transaction and lottery draw is recorded on a public ledger, providing participants with unprecedented transparency into the entire process. This level of transparency builds trust among players and reduces the risk of manipulation or fraud.

Additionally, cryptocurrency lotteries offer global accessibility, allowing individuals from anywhere in the world to participate without being restricted by geographical boundaries or currency exchange rates. This inclusivity enhances the overall gaming experience and expands the potential player base.

Moreover, cryptocurrency transactions offer a higher degree of anonymity and privacy compared to traditional payment methods. Participants can engage in lottery activities without disclosing sensitive personal information, enhancing security and confidentiality.

Challenges and Risks

Despite their numerous advantages, cryptocurrency lotteries also face several challenges and risks. One significant concern is the regulatory landscape, as authorities worldwide grapple with the classification and oversight of these emerging platforms. Uncertainty surrounding regulations can hinder the growth and adoption of cryptocurrency lotteries, creating barriers to entry for both operators and players.

Security is another critical issue, as the decentralized nature of cryptocurrencies makes them susceptible to hacking and theft. Participants must exercise caution and adopt robust security measures to protect their funds and personal information from malicious actors.

Furthermore, the inherent volatility of cryptocurrencies introduces additional risks for participants. The value of digital assets can fluctuate dramatically, affecting the purchasing power of lottery tickets and the perceived value of prizes.

Integration of Blockchain Technology

Blockchain technology plays a pivotal role in the operation of cryptocurrency lotteries, offering enhanced security, transparency, and trust. Each transaction and lottery draw is recorded on a decentralized ledger, ensuring immutability and verifiability.

By leveraging blockchain technology, cryptocurrency lotteries can guarantee the integrity of every draw and eliminate the possibility of tampering or manipulation. This level of transparency instills confidence among participants and fosters a fair and equitable gaming environment.

Legal and Regulatory Framework

The legal and regulatory landscape surrounding cryptocurrency lotteries varies from country to country, with some jurisdictions embracing innovation and others adopting a more cautious approach. It’s crucial for operators to navigate these regulatory challenges carefully and ensure compliance with applicable laws and regulations.

As governments around the world continue to develop frameworks for digital assets and blockchain technology, we can expect to see evolving regulations that shape the future of cryptocurrency lotteries. Operators must remain vigilant and adaptable, proactively addressing regulatory changes and safeguarding the interests of their players.
